ORACLE数据库系统1 Or acle 数据库基础1
1 字符方式下的ORACLE工具
SQL * PLUS 是ORACLE RDBMS 软件的组成部分用来在ORACLE 数据库上执行一些动态的查询和命令通常在创建数据库对象时使用1)SQL * FORMS SQL*FORMS 是用于迅速开发基于表格FORM的应用程序的工具 Sql*forms(design) 设计部件 (Run Form) (Generate) 生成执行文件 (Conver)转换部件1)SQL * MENU 是一个软件工具它提供一个菜单接口运行其他的软件产品2)SQL * ReportWriter 报表生成器3)第三代语言接口工具(Proc * C等) COBOLCFORTRANPLIPASCALADA与ORACLE RDBMS的接口1
2 ORACLE的网络产品及其功能
1)SQL * NET SQL*NET使ORACLE的客户机和服务器在网络上能够进行通信功能 客户机与服务器之间的连接是由SQL*NET建立和撤消的SQL*NET将ORACLE应用程序UPI调用和数据库的请求转换成网络上的请求两个通信接点之间不同字符集和NLS数据表示是通过SQL*NET来处理的SQL*NET 协调多个接点上的中断处理SQL*NET V2 和多协议转换器允许ORACLE 客户机和服务器在异构网络上进行通信SQL*NET V2 是ORACLE 进行远程数据存取的网络软件它使得在一个单一网络上存取信息成为可能多协议转换器使SQL*NET V2 能与多种协议连接2)ORACLE SQL * CONNECT1
3 理解ORACLE数据库中主要实体
1)表 表是最主要的数据库对象用它来存储系统中的数据2)视图 可以认为视图是数据库中的逻辑表视图由一个与定义的查询组成可像表一样用于ORACLE查询中3)索引 索引是一种树形结构使用